Product Overview

NPWT offers significant clinical benefits for large, chronic wounds and acute, complicated wounds. It removes excess exudate and any infectious material that may be present in the wound, providing an ideal and clean environment to promote wound healing across various wound types. This system supports faster healing and is applicable for both hospital use and home care.

Key Advantages

  • Real-time pressure monitoring for enhanced safety.
  • Canister overflow prevention with advanced anti-sloshing design.
  • Powerful performance providing up to 200 mmHg Pressure.
  • 3 versatile treatment modes: continuous, intermittent, and dynamic.
  • Dual power supply with integrated battery supporting up to 12 hours of operation.
  • Periodic instillation washing for optimal wound environment (NP-800).
